4-4 | Model 241CE II Hydrocarbon Dewpoint Analyzer
Keypad
The four push-buttons allow you to navigate throughout the software
to view previous results, change operating parameters, and disable,
enable, and reset alarms.
Each button uses an automatic-repeat action. For any operation that
requires you to press the button more than once, press and hold the
button to repeat the function. After pressing the button continuously
for 1.5 seconds, the function associated with the button will be re-
peated four times per second. After pressing and holding the button
for 5 more seconds, the function is repeated 10 times per second, with
the step size of the function being 10 times larger if applicable. This is
useful when setting values.
The push-button functions are:
Push-Button Functions/Uses
Use the button:
To scroll through the main menu items from RUN Mode. Press this button
repeatedly to view other main menu items.
Use the button:
To scroll through the sub-menu items. Press this button repeatedly to
view other sub-menu items.
To return to the RUN menu from other menus through the sub-menu
items. Press this button repeatedly to view other sub-menu items.
To skip prompts without making a selection (i.e., whenever ‘?’ appears
following information).
To scroll through a menu to nd prompts, such as “Save AppCFG?” when
changes to the Application Conguration menu parameter settings need
to be saved.
As part of a password.
+ Use the ‘+ button:
To scroll through selectable options for certain sub-menu item (e.g., User
Relay).
To view the last nine measuring cycles (‘1’ = most recent entry; ‘9 = old-
est entry), from the Stat\History menu (^HCD). <<Verify this!!!
To increase the value of the displayed parameter.
To answer ‘Yes’ to a prompt (whenever ‘? appears following information,
such as “Save AppCFG?”).
To enable the O󰀨-Spec Alarm from the Stat\History menu if the O󰀨-Spec
Alarm is currently disabled (when “En\Dis Alarm?” is displayed).
As part of a password.
Use the ‘’ button:
To view the last nine measuring cycles (‘1’ = most recent entry; ‘9 = old-
est entry), from the Stat\History menu (^HCD). <<Verify this!!!
To decrease the value of the displayed parameter.
To answer ‘No’ to a prompt (whenever ‘? appears following information,
such as “Save AppCFG?”).
To disable the O󰀨-Spec Alarm from the Stat\History menu if the O󰀨-Spec
Alarm is currently enabled (when “En\Dis Alarm?” is displayed).
As part of a password.
